- Abstract
The article investigates the spatial distribution of the electromagnetic (EM) field of an an- tenna in the form of a long grounded cable in a rock with the corresponding electrophysical parameters. The frequency dependences of the emitted EM fields (300 Hz – 30 kHz) on the depth of the receiver po- sition are determined. This is of practical importance for the problems of wireless mine communications
